引言
扇形条形统计图是数据可视化的重要工具,它们能够帮助我们直观地理解数据的分布和比例。在日常生活和工作中,正确运用扇形图和条形图可以轻松解决许多计算难题。本文将详细介绍这两种图表的制作方法、应用场景以及如何利用它们进行数据分析。
扇形图
什么是扇形图?
扇形图(Pie Chart)是一种圆形图表,用于显示数据部分与整体的比例关系。每个扇形代表一个数据部分,其大小与该部分占整体的比例成正比。
制作扇形图
- 确定数据:收集并整理需要展示的数据。
- 计算比例:将每个数据部分除以总数据量,得到比例。
- 绘制图表:使用图表绘制工具(如Excel、Python的Matplotlib库等)绘制扇形图。
示例
假设有一家公司,其员工分为以下部门:销售部(30人)、技术部(20人)、市场部(15人)、行政部(10人)、财务部(5人)。如何用扇形图展示各部门员工人数占总人数的比例?
import matplotlib.pyplot as plt
# 数据
departments = ['销售部', '技术部', '市场部', '行政部', '财务部']
employees = [30, 20, 15, 10, 5]
# 绘制扇形图
plt.pie(employees, labels=departments, autopct='%1.1f%%')
plt.axis('equal') # 保持饼图为圆形
plt.show()
应用场景
扇形图适用于展示数据部分与整体的关系,如市场份额、人口比例等。
条形图
什么是条形图?
条形图(Bar Chart)是一种用条形表示数据大小的图表,用于比较不同类别之间的数据。
制作条形图
- 确定数据:收集并整理需要展示的数据。
- 选择坐标轴:根据数据类型选择合适的坐标轴。
- 绘制图表:使用图表绘制工具绘制条形图。
示例
假设我们要比较四个城市的平均气温,数据如下:
| 城市 | 平均气温(℃) |
|---|---|
| 北京 | 12 |
| 上海 | 15 |
| 广州 | 22 |
| 深圳 | 19 |
如何用条形图展示这些数据?
import matplotlib.pyplot as plt
# 数据
cities = ['北京', '上海', '广州', '深圳']
temperatures = [12, 15, 22, 19]
# 绘制条形图
plt.bar(cities, temperatures)
plt.xlabel('城市')
plt.ylabel('平均气温(℃)')
plt.title('四个城市的平均气温')
plt.show()
应用场景
条形图适用于比较不同类别之间的数据,如销售额、人口数量等。
总结
掌握扇形图和条形图,可以帮助我们更好地理解和分析数据。在实际应用中,根据数据类型和展示需求选择合适的图表,可以更加直观地传达信息。通过本文的学习,相信你已经具备了运用这两种图表解决计算难题的能力。
